Transaction 15256e439f60d88992d996998ded37cc3c705a14020d8d0324fdb8df83189c94
1 Input
1 Output
-
15256e439f60d88992d996998ded37cc3c705a14020d8d0324fdb8df83189c94:0
- value
- 52281
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f9226d51f02b4e11422b4012c4e4e5267f6fd035 OP_EQUAL
- address
- 3QQKRLmSdu9Bbuhce6ieRtxkEcJ1VnT7dM